Materials and Construction

The choice of material is a key factor that Fry Pan Manufacturers consider. Common materials include stainless steel, aluminum, carbon steel, and cast iron. Each has its own benefits: stainless steel is durable and resistant to corrosion, aluminum is lightweight and offers rapid heat conduction, carbon steel heats evenly and develops a natural non-stick layer over time, and cast iron provides heat retention.

Many manufacturers also apply non-stick coatings to enhance convenience and reduce the amount of oil needed for cooking. This coating requires careful selection and application to ensure that it adheres properly and lasts through repeated use. Properly manufactured fry pans can maintain their functionality and appearance for years.

Design and Functionality

Functionality is another important consideration for Fry Pan Manufacturers. Handles are designed to provide comfort and reduce heat transfer, while pans are often shaped to allow easy flipping, stirring, and serving of food. Some fry pans include measurement marks or detachable handles to improve convenience, especially in professional kitchens.

The shape and weight distribution of a fry pan also influence cooking performance. Even heating across the surface is critical to avoid hot spots that can burn food. Fry pan manufacturers often test pans under different conditions to ensure consistent heat distribution, which is particularly important for commercial kitchens where efficiency and quality are priorities.

Production Process

Modern Fry Pan Manufacturers use a combination of casting, stamping, and forging processes depending on the pan type. Cast iron pans are usually molded and seasoned during production, while aluminum and stainless steel pans may go through stamping or deep drawing. After the basic shape is created, pans are polished, coated, and fitted with handles.

Quality control is an integral part of the process. Each pan is inspected for surface integrity, coating adhesion, and handle strength. Testing ensures that the pans meet both safety standards and functional requirements before they are shipped to retailers or restaurants.
